I am the trench
A project about the village’s historical, cultural and environmental heritage of Grigno

The exhibition features photos and excerpts of texts by the pupils and teachers from Grigno Primary School’s Class 4E and the Secondary School’s Class 1D following a project about the village’s historical, cultural and environmental heritage. The heart of the project is the discovery, or rather rediscovery, of the Grigno Trench, a recently renovated First World War structure. Over the decades the trench has been undervalued and used for various unintended purposes. Pupils learned to appreciate the value of their precious local heritage, inscribed in world history and etched into the local landscape, through a process of rediscovery.
During the project the children and teachers were invited to "give a voice" to the trench in order to understand it, making it a personal and collective heritage.
The preferred research instrument was the camera, which encouraged them to observe the place and the environment in which they are immersed.
The cultural biography of the trench was reconstructed by interweaving the stories of individuals, the village and the wider history, to conserve a precious cultural heritage whose own story traverses time and space.
During the time of the exhibition, work by the children of Grigno Nursery School will be exhibited following a similar project of discovery and documentation called The Trench and Me.
